How they compare
Niger currently reports 45.42 million NFL, current US$ against 43.01 million NFL, current US$ in Congo, a difference of 2.41 million NFL, current US$.
That makes Niger's figure about 1.1 times Congo's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 24 shared years of data; in 1971 it was Niger ahead.
Congo ranks 26th and Niger ranks 25th of 109 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Congo averaged higher in 3 and Niger in 1.

About this data
Net financial flows received by the borrower during the year are disbursements of loans and credits less repayments of principal. IMF is the International Monetary Fund, which provides nonconcessional lending through the credit it provides to its members, mainly to meet balance of payments needs.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
